I completed Final Fantasy XII's main storyline a month ago, and since there are no promising titles on the horizon for this summer, I figured I would revisit the game and start the process of completing the game with respects to hunts, the Necrohol of Nabudis, gathering all the final hunts as well as joining the Hunt Club.
I picked back up at the 80:04h save point, just prior to the game's final level and took my main party (Vaan Lvl 61, Fran lvl 57, Basch lvl 61) to the
Stillshrine of Miriam to take down the optional esper,
Zeromus the Condemner.
I had originally tried to capture this hidden esper when my party was around level 23, and it was a joke -- instant death. Returning 40 levels later, it was
still a serious challenge. At one point, there spawned a 15 Dark Lord bodyguard!
Game Hint: Make sure your first two gambits are Phoenix Down and Chronos Tear, or you'll never get through this boss. Sorry, the rest you'll have to figure out for yourself. :)
It took 4 attempts with subsequent tweaks to my party's gambits before I was able to capture Zeromus. The fight when I captured Zeromus took
35 minutes of constant fighting!
If you're like me, you might find normal FF XII gameplay to be a little stale once your party goes above level 50. But, fear not! Any hunt that's above Rank III will provide a serious gaming challenge. And forget about Rank VII and VIII marks!!
